Background

The County of San Mateo, CA is seeking the services of a professional event planning company to support the planning and hosting of public-facing and stakeholder-focused events to increase participation in sustainability programs and activities related to waste, carbon pollution, climate resilience, and schools and youth programs hosted by the County and/or other partners. The selected vendor will be responsible for supporting the County in delivering polished, well-organized, and accessible events that aim to educate and engage the public, build relationships, and encourage attendees to take advantage of publicly funded programs and resources.

The vendor will work with the County and its partners to attract diverse audiences. Different events may attract different audiences, including public agency staff, real estate professionals, trades people, small businesses owners, educators, homeowners, and apartment owners, as well as the general community, to events that may include, but are not limited to:

  • Summits, retreats, and networking events
  • Cooking classes or demonstrations
  • Trainings for professional audiences
  • Workshops to promote programs
  • Focus groups or forums
  • Open houses, home tours
  • Listening sessions
  • Pop-up outreach events
  • Community meetings, fairs and festivals
  • Town halls
  • Neighborhood meetings
  • Ribbon cuttings and grand openings
  • Youth events

A successful proposal will demonstrate the following capabilities:

  • Experience in planning and executing events.
  • Strong project management skills, including the ability to manage multiple activities and vendors simultaneously and meet deadlines.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work effectively with County staff, vendors, and community stakeholders.
  • Proficiency in using event management software and tools, including online registration platforms and marketing automation tools.
  • Commitment to diversity, equity, and inclusion, with a focus on creating accessible and inclusive events for all community members.

The County anticipates establishing a five-year on-call contract with the selected vendor with a not-to-exceed amount. The County will create task orders with the vendor to work on individual events during the contract period.
